Verse (45:18), Word 9 - Quranic Grammar

__

The ninth word of verse (45:18) is a form VIII imperfect verb (فعل مضارع). The verb is second person masculine singular and is in the jussive mood (مجزوم). The verb's triliteral root is tā bā ʿayn (ت ب ع).

Chapter (45) sūrat l-jāthiyah (Crouching)


(45:18:9)
tattabiʿ
follow
V – 2nd person masculine singular (form VIII) imperfect verb, jussive mood فعل مضارع مجزوم

Verse (45:18)

The analysis above refers to the eighteenth verse of chapter 45 (sūrat l-jāthiyah):

Sahih International: Then We put you, [O Muhammad], on an ordained way concerning the matter [of religion]; so follow it and do not follow the inclinations of those who do not know.
